Big 2nd half lifts Trojans over Altoona, 28-10

ALTOONA — Chambersburg’s offense squandered several chances to take an early lead against Altoona, misfiring on three fourth-down plays inside the Mountain Lions’ 35-yard line in the first quarter alone.

But the Trojans wiped out deficits of 7-0 and 10-6 by scoring three touchdowns in the fourth quarter and defeated Altoona 28-10 in a Mid Penn Commonwealth game at Mansion Park on Friday night.

“It was a total team effort, and it was the most complete game we’ve played this year,” Trojan coach Gary Carter said.

Chambersburg’s defense kept giving the offense chances by creating six turnovers (4 interceptions, 2 fumble recoveries), and all three of the fourth-quarter scores came after a turnover.

Trailing 10-6, a Devon Nalewak punt pushed the Mountain Lions (2-6, 2-5 MPC) back to their own 16. On the second play, Altoona quarterback Mehki Jackson was intercepted by Bryson Murray, who stepped in front of the receiver, giving his team the ball at the Lion 14.

An unsportsmanlike conduct penalty pushed Chambersburg (4-4, 3-4 MPC) back to the 21, but on third-and-8, QB Cam Green hit Davonte Scott down the right side for the go-ahead touchdown. Malachi Tasker ran for two points, giving the Trojans a 14-10 advantage with 7:09 left.

Carter said, “We game-planned the second half just like the first. We ran the same plays, but this time they worked. Guys made plays.”

Then came perhaps the biggest play of the game. On first down, Mountain Lion fullback Julian Hazlewood had the ball jarred loose and it was recovered by Chambersburg’s Eli Vosburg on the Altoona 27.

Four straight carries by Malachi Tasker, helped by a big push from the offensive line, put the ball across the goal line, with his final carry going for 4 yards. With Ayden Silvestre’s kick, it was now 21-10.

“We really wanted to run the ball tonight, and we did it better,” Carter said. “The entire offensive line, the tight ends and even the fullbacks — any of the kids we brought in — they got after it. Malachi was able to run downhill.”

The defense did it again, when Brady Rosenberry dropped back into coverage from his linebacker position and snagged another interception two plays later.

Taking over at the 18, Chambersburg used the clock and finished the drive on a 4-yard play-action pass from Green to Cobe Penick with 33 seconds left to ice the game.

Carter said, “Of our whole defense, not one kid we put in there didn’t play well. Enoch Keath got hurt, but the guys who went in (Aiden Castillo, Daunye Welsh) played well. We even had a freshman linebacker (Deakon Snavely) come in and do well. Our defensive coordinators had a great game plan.”

The Mountain Lions’ triple option attack was hemmed in most of the night. But it did put together one 19-play, 70-yard drive in the second quarter to take a 7-0 lead. Altoona was 3-for-3 on third downs and also got a fourth-down conversion before Jackson scored from 3 yards out.

Interceptions by Isaiah Tasker and Cobe Penick stopped drives by Altoona in the first half, and Cooper Stockslager got a hand on a 38-yard field goal attempt just before halftime to deflect it.

In the second half, the Mountain Lions mustered only three first downs and 70 yards total.

Chambersburg’s first touchdown came on a 38-yard pass from Green to Scott, on which Scott burned his defender with a post move.

NOTES: Scott finished with 4 catches for 81 yards and 2 TDs … Green hit on 13 of 19 passes for 177 yards and 3 scores (and no picks) … Tasker finished with 22 carries for 61 yards and a TD … Chambersburg hosts Cumberland Valley on Friday at 7 p.m.
